MSN’s Member Experience merchandizing team wants to fill several immediately-opened positions with experienced Software Development Engineers to create the next service-oriented merchandizing site.

The currently-existing property already receives millions of users per month in dozens of countries and will be replaced by a cross-Microsoft services -merchandizing application, including fee and paid services. We are the gateway for many of MSN’s online revenue-generating services and crucial to the success of MSN, and we achieve that by providing dynamic and personalized experiences for each user. Going forward, we will be extending that charter to small business and other “live” services.

The successful candidate will work on the UI and other front-end infrastructure components necessary to build a dynamic, scalable, and targeted user experience that drives the user to a “purchase” decision.

You will work with teams throughout MSN to build, extend, and maintain this new application. We are looking for someone able to design and document new features to projects from beginning to end with little direct supervision. You should have been through at least one major, high-scale web application/site release in the past, and know what it takes to ship such as project.

A BA/BS degree or equivalent in Computer Science or related technical field preferred.

REQUIRED SKILLS:

Detail-oriented and willing to take on big challenges in a short release cycle; exceptional cross-team collaboration skills and a desire to work within a multi-disciplinary environment.

Development skills: HTML, Javascript, and CSS expert, as well as thorough understanding of IIS and web debugging required. Software development skills: Must have a thorough understanding of the .NET Framework and related technologies; ASP.NET, C#.
